The Texas Rangers are now involved in the state investigation of claims of neglect by Camp Mystic during last summer’s deadly flood in the Hill Country.

Lieutenant Governor Dan Patrick asked the Department of State Health Services on Tuesday not to renew the camp’s license in the middle of a criminal investigation. It’s not clear who may be prosecuted or what the charges could be. Two counselors and 25 campers drowned at the camp during a flash flood on July 4th.
